Output 24c63e6075543166810879747894881b4962639f14a1a3b9398c7e69aeb64530:0

value
67253
script pubkey
OP_0 OP_PUSHBYTES_20 eac38c78193a534347bafbbb2f182a0fc45216fc
address
bc1qatpcc7qe8ff5x3a6lwaj7xp2plz9y9hummjjc5
transaction
24c63e6075543166810879747894881b4962639f14a1a3b9398c7e69aeb64530